Agnico Eagle Mines' Upper Beaver Gold Project is situated on the traditional homelands of the Apitipi Anicinapek Nation, Beaverhouse First Nation, Matachewan First Nation, and Timiskaming First Nation. We prioritize hiring Members from these Nations. Members seeking employment at the Upper Beaver Gold Project are encouraged to self-identify during the application process to ensure proper consideration, aligning with our commitment to supporting our Partner Nations.
